    In the Americas (defined as International Telecommunication Union (ITU) region 2), the FM broadcast band consists of 101 channels, each 200 kHz wide, in the frequency range from 87.8 to 108.0 MHz, with "center frequencies" running from 87.9 MHz to 107.9 MHz. For most purposes an FM station is associated with its center frequency.

    The song was co-written by Kiesza and Rami Samir Afuni, and produced by the latter. "Giant in My Heart" is an electropop and house track sung in an emotive falsetto tone and features a combination of scat-singing, a pounding 808 and softer synth-led sections. Lyrically, the song focuses on subjects of love lost and the aftermath of a breakup.
